Sat 713764576305574

decimal
142752.4576305574
degree
0°142752′1632″4576305574‴
percentile
33.98878938527216%
name
iuhecwpsszb
cycle
0
epoch
0
period
70
block
142752
offset
4576305574
rarity
common
timestamp